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it a69143f3 authored by Treehugger Robot's avatar Treehugger Robot Committed by Automerger Merge Worker
Browse files

Merge "am dumpheap throws error when arguments are after file" into main am:...

Merge "am dumpheap throws error when arguments are after file" into main am: 7e0989d9 am: 19b728ba

Original change: https://android-review.googlesource.com/c/platform/frameworks/base/+/3363789



Change-Id: Ib53be16047db865de39172ca23b7300fd701a129
Signed-off-by: default avatarAutomerger Merge Worker <android-build-automerger-merge-worker@system.gserviceaccount.com>
parents 2922eb65 19b728ba
Loading
Loading
Loading
Loading
+6 −0
Original line number Diff line number Diff line
@@ -1407,6 +1407,12 @@ final class ActivityManagerShellCommand extends ShellCommand {
            heapFile = "/data/local/tmp/heapdump-" + logNameTimeString + ".prof";
        }

        String argAfterHeapFile = getNextArg();
        if (argAfterHeapFile != null) {
            err.println("Error: Arguments cannot be placed after the heap file");
            return -1;
        }

        // Writes an error message to stderr on failure
        ParcelFileDescriptor fd = openFileForSystem(heapFile, "w");
        if (fd == null) {